Rumah >pangkalan data >tutorial mysql >pertanyaan mysql semua jadual

pertanyaan mysql semua jadual

王林
王林asal
2023-05-20 10:08:0718429semak imbas

MySQL ialah sistem pengurusan pangkalan data hubungan sumber terbuka yang digunakan secara meluas dalam pelbagai aplikasi web kerana ia sangat boleh disesuaikan dan mudah diurus. MySQL mengandungi satu set operasi yang membolehkan anda membuat, mengemas kini dan membuat pertanyaan data dalam pangkalan data anda. Salah satu operasi penting ialah menanyakan data semua jadual Artikel ini akan memperkenalkan cara untuk mencapai operasi ini.

1. Gunakan arahan SHOW TABLES

Arahan SHOW TABLES ialah cara paling mudah dan langsung untuk menanyakan semua jadual. Ia akan memaparkan senarai semua jadual yang terdapat dalam pangkalan data. Menggunakan arahan ini, anda boleh mengetahui dengan serta-merta bilangan jadual yang terkandung dalam setiap pangkalan data.

Berikut ialah langkah untuk menanyakan semua jadual menggunakan arahan SHOW TABLES:

  1. Buka konsol MySQL atau sambung ke pelayan pangkalan data melalui alat baris arahan MySQL.
  2. Pilih pangkalan data untuk membuat pertanyaan. Masukkan salah satu daripada arahan berikut:
USE database_name;

Ingat bahawa nama_pangkalan data mesti digantikan dengan nama pangkalan data sebenar yang anda ingin tanyakan.

  1. Gunakan arahan SHOW TABLES. Masukkan arahan berikut:
SHOW TABLES;

Arahan ini akan memaparkan senarai semua jadual yang terkandung dalam pangkalan data yang dipilih.

2. Gunakan INFORMATION_SCHEMA

MySQL juga menyediakan kaedah yang lebih maju untuk menanyakan data semua jadual, iaitu INFORMATION_SCHEMA. Kaedah ini menyediakan carian pangkalan data yang lebih terperinci dan fleksibel, membolehkan anda memilih lajur tertentu, menapis dan menyusun hasil, dsb.

Berikut ialah langkah untuk menanyakan semua jadual menggunakan INFORMATION_SCHEMA:

  1. Buka konsol MySQL atau sambung ke pelayan pangkalan data melalui alat baris arahan MySQL.
  2. Pilih pangkalan data untuk membuat pertanyaan. Masukkan salah satu daripada arahan berikut:
USE database_name;

Ingat bahawa nama_pangkalan data mesti digantikan dengan nama pangkalan data sebenar yang anda ingin tanyakan.

  1. Gunakan pernyataan SELECT dan panggil jadual INFORMATION_SCHEMA.TABLES. Masukkan arahan berikut:
SELECT table_name
FROM information_schema.tables
WHERE table_schema = 'database_name';

Ingat bahawa nama_pangkalan data mesti digantikan dengan nama pangkalan data sebenar yang anda ingin tanya.

Arahan ini akan mengembalikan nama semua jadual yang terkandung dalam pangkalan data yang dipilih.

3. Ringkasan

Di atas ialah dua kaedah untuk menanyakan semua jadual dalam MySQL. Perintah SHOW TABLES menyediakan cara yang cepat dan mudah untuk menyenaraikan semua jadual, manakala INFORMATION_SCHEMA lebih berkuasa, menyediakan lebih banyak pilihan carian dan penyenaraian maklumat terperinci. Bergantung pada keperluan anda, anda boleh memilih antara dua kaedah ini dan menyesuaikan hasilnya dengan keperluan pertanyaan khusus anda.

Atas ialah kandungan terperinci pertanyaan mysql semua jadual. Untuk maklumat lanjut, sila ikut artikel berkaitan lain di laman web China PHP!

Kenyataan:
Kandungan artikel ini disumbangkan secara sukarela oleh netizen, dan hak cipta adalah milik pengarang asal. Laman web ini tidak memikul tanggungjawab undang-undang yang sepadan. Jika anda menemui sebarang kandungan yang disyaki plagiarisme atau pelanggaran, sila hubungi admin@php.cn
Artikel sebelumnya:Padamkan data pendua mysqlArtikel seterusnya:Padamkan data pendua mysql